Solve the all parts of given question:
Question: A 70 g disk sits on a horizontally rotating turntable. The turntable makes exactly 4 revolutions each second. The disk is located 16 cm from the axis of rotation of the turntable.
Part A: What is the frictional force acting on the disk?
Part B: The disk will slide off the turntable if it is located at a radius larger than 22 cm from the axis of rotation, what is the coefficient of static friction?
